What These Numbers Mean for San Tan Valley Buyers and Sellers
San Tan Valley's housing market, tracked in the Housing Market Trends module above, currently shows a median sale price of $430,000 with prices moving -0.1% year over year. The measured combination of 3.0 months of supply and a median 64 days on market points to a market where negotiating leverage has shifted toward buyers. With 882 active listings against 292 homes sold monthly, buyers have more options and more time to evaluate them than they did a year ago, reflected in a +6 days change in market time.
The clearest signal for buyers is the price-drop share: 31.9% of listings have reduced their asking price, while only 18.8% of homes sold above list and just 12.9% left the market within two weeks. Taken together, these indicators suggest buyers can often negotiate below asking, particularly on listings that have aged past the 64-day median. The sale-to-list ratio of 98.90% confirms that most closings settle modestly under the seller's initial number.
For sellers, the analysis argues for disciplined pricing from day one. Homes priced ahead of the $214.54 per square foot benchmark risk joining the nearly one-third of listings that require a reduction, which typically extends time on market. Pricing at or slightly under comparable sales tends to preserve leverage and limit concessions. In a market with 771 licensed agents competing across zip codes 85140 and 85143, the difference between a well-positioned listing and an overpriced one increasingly comes down to representation and local pricing judgment.

What commission do San Tan Valley realtors charge?
Commissions are negotiable and vary by agent, service level, and transaction. There is no set rate, and recent industry changes have made commission structures more flexible than ever. Discuss the structure directly with your agent before signing a listing or buyer agreement.
Should I use a local San Tan Valley agent or a national brand?
The individual agent matters more than the brand on the sign. Offices within the same national franchise vary widely in performance, and the agent you hire, not the logo, prices your home, negotiates your contract, and manages your closing. A strong local agent brings firsthand knowledge of San Tan Valley neighborhoods, pricing patterns, and buyer activity. Compare agents on verified local results such as recent sales, days on market, and negotiation outcomes rather than name recognition.
What questions should I ask a San Tan Valley realtor before hiring them?
Ask how many homes they have closed in San Tan Valley in the past year, what their average sale-to-list ratio is, and how much of their business is in your neighborhood and price range. Ask how they will market your home or find you listings, and how often they will communicate. Strong agents answer with specifics. Verified transaction data is the fastest way to confirm what you hear.
